ZHCS889Q June 2007 – August 2022 TMS320F28232 , TMS320F28232-Q1 , TMS320F28234 , TMS320F28234-Q1 , TMS320F28235 , TMS320F28235-Q1 , TMS320F28332 , TMS320F28333 , TMS320F28334 , TMS320F28335 , TMS320F28335-Q1
PRODUCTION DATA
請(qǐng)參考 PDF 數(shù)據(jù)表獲取器件具體的封裝圖。
在 器件上有 3 個(gè) 32 位 CPU 計(jì)時(shí)器 (CPU 計(jì)時(shí)器 0,CPU 計(jì)時(shí)器 1,CPU 計(jì)時(shí)器 2)。
CPU 計(jì)時(shí)器 2 為 DSP/BIOS 或 SYS/BIOS 保留??梢栽谟脩魬?yīng)用程序中使用 CPU 計(jì)時(shí)器 0 和計(jì)時(shí)器 1。這些計(jì)時(shí)器與 ePWM 模塊中的計(jì)時(shí)器不同。
如果應(yīng)用不使用 DSP/BIOS 和 SYS/BIOS,那么 CPU 計(jì)時(shí)器 2 可用在應(yīng)用中。
圖 8-2 CPU 計(jì)時(shí)器計(jì)時(shí)器中斷信號(hào) (TINT0、TINT1、TINT2) 的連接如圖 8-3 所示。

計(jì)時(shí)器的一般操作如下:32 位計(jì)數(shù)器寄存器“TIMH:TIM”會(huì)加載周期寄存器“PRDH:PRD”中的值。計(jì)數(shù)器寄存器按 C28 x 的 SYSCLKOUT 頻率遞減。當(dāng)計(jì)數(shù)器到達(dá) 0 時(shí),一個(gè)計(jì)時(shí)器中斷輸出信號(hào)生成一個(gè)中斷脈沖。表 8-3中列出的寄存器用于配置計(jì)時(shí)器。更多信息,請(qǐng)參閱 TMS320x2833x、TMS320x2823x 實(shí)時(shí)微控制器技術(shù)參考手冊(cè) 中的“系統(tǒng)控制和中斷”一章。
| 名稱 | 地址 | 大小 (x16) | 說明 |
|---|---|---|---|
| TIMER0TIM | 0x0C00 | 1 | CPU 計(jì)時(shí)器 0,計(jì)數(shù)器寄存器 |
| TIMER0TIMH | 0x0C01 | 1 | CPU 計(jì)時(shí)器 0,計(jì)數(shù)器寄存器高電平 |
| TIMER0PRD | 0x0C02 | 1 | CPU 計(jì)時(shí)器 0,周期寄存器 |
| TIMER0PRDH | 0x0C03 | 1 | CPU 計(jì)時(shí)器 0,周期寄存器高電平 |
| TIMER0TCR | 0x0C04 | 1 | CPU 計(jì)時(shí)器 0,控制寄存器 |
| 保留 | 0x0C05 | 1 | |
| TIMER0TPR | 0x0C06 | 1 | CPU 計(jì)時(shí)器 0,預(yù)分頻寄存器 |
| TIMER0TPRH | 0x0C07 | 1 | CPU 計(jì)時(shí)器 0,預(yù)分頻寄存器高電平 |
| TIMER1TIM | 0x0C08 | 1 | CPU 計(jì)時(shí)器 1,計(jì)數(shù)器寄存器 |
| TIMER1TIMH | 0x0C09 | 1 | CPU 計(jì)時(shí)器 1,計(jì)數(shù)器寄存器高電平 |
| TIMER1PRD | 0x0C0A | 1 | CPU 計(jì)時(shí)器 1,周期寄存器 |
| TIMER1PRDH | 0x0C0B | 1 | CPU 計(jì)時(shí)器 1,周期寄存器高電平 |
| TIMER1TCR | 0x0C0C | 1 | CPU 計(jì)時(shí)器 1,控制寄存器 |
| 保留 | 0x0C0D | 1 | |
| TIMER1TPR | 0x0C0E | 1 | CPU 計(jì)時(shí)器 1,預(yù)分頻寄存器 |
| TIMER1TPRH | 0x0C0F | 1 | CPU 計(jì)時(shí)器 1,預(yù)分頻寄存器高電平 |
| TIMER2TIM | 0x0C10 | 1 | CPU 計(jì)時(shí)器 2,計(jì)數(shù)器寄存器 |
| TIMER2TIMH | 0x0C11 | 1 | CPU 計(jì)時(shí)器 2,計(jì)數(shù)器寄存器高電平 |
| TIMER2PRD | 0x0C12 | 1 | CPU 計(jì)時(shí)器 2,周期寄存器 |
| TIMER2PRDH | 0x0C13 | 1 | CPU 計(jì)時(shí)器 2,周期寄存器高電平 |
| TIMER2TCR | 0x0C14 | 1 | CPU 計(jì)時(shí)器 2,控制寄存器 |
| 保留 | 0x0C15 | 1 | |
| TIMER2TPR | 0x0C16 | 1 | CPU 計(jì)時(shí)器 2,預(yù)分頻寄存器 |
| TIMER2TPRH | 0x0C17 | 1 | CPU 計(jì)時(shí)器 2,預(yù)分頻寄存器高電平 |
| 保留 | x0 C18-0x0 0C3F | 40 |